HB 870·MS·house

Boyd Mason Act; create sales tax exemption for veterans having 100% permanent service-connected disability.

FailedFiled Jan 16, 2026
Sponsor: Fondren
Latest Action

(H) Died In Committee

Feb 25, 2026

Summary

The bill would amend Mississippi’s sales‑tax code to exempt purchases of tangible personal property and services made by residents who are honorably discharged veterans certified by the VA as having a 100% permanent service‑connected disability. The exemption also extends to the surviving spouse and to purchases made on the veteran’s behalf by an authorized household member when the veteran is not present. An annual cap on the total amount of exempt sales would be set.
